About the Journal

Focus and Scope

Nova Scientia is a multidisciplinary, peer reviewed electronic scientific journal published by the Universidad La Salle Bajío twice a year in the months of May and November. It publishes original high quality peer-reviewed papers, both fundamental and applications, from different scientific disciplines including, natural science, engineering, life science, biotechnology, material science, education, social science, human behavior and economy, written by national and international researchers and academics. It is well received to be considered for publications letters and full-length articles in a regular process and reviews by invitation, in 2020 the rejection rate was 80 %.

Since 2012 it has been the best evaluated journal in its category in the CONACYT Index.

Peer Review Process

All submitted manuscript must be reviewed by external referees to be accepted for publication. Here in this section we describe such process.

Evaluation of pertinence

In order to assess the quality and feasibility of the submitted manuscript, the Editorial Board of Nova Scientia reviews its pertinence before submitting them to the peer review process carried out by reviewers experts in the field of your manuscript.

Editors may reject a manuscript without external review if they judge is unsuitable for the journal (e.g. out of scope, duplicate information, too wordy, incremental or not clear contribution).

Arbitration process

Peer-review comprises at least two external reviewers that read and analyze the manuscript in order to recommend about both the validity of the ideas and the results, as well as their potential scientific impact. Following the practices of the different specialties for the area of Natural Sciences and Engineering, the single-blind variant will be used, in which the arbitrators know the name of the author they evaluate. For the area of Human and Social sciences, the double-blind study variant will be used, in which the anonymity of the arbitrator and the author is preserved.

Reviewers provide comments in order to help author create better manuscript. Reviewers will recommend that:

  • The manuscript is acceptable for publication as is.
  • The manuscript requires minor correction.
  • The manuscript requires major correction and further revision.
  • The manuscript is not acceptable for publication.

Editor makes a publication decision of submitted manuscript based on the reviews recommendation and send decision letter. In case of controversy editorial board can select a third reviewer to take the final decision. It is the intention of Nova Scientia that referees be selected among the most competent scientist expert in the field of your manuscript. The number of referees exceeds 4,000 and all nationals belong to the Sistema Nacional de Investigadores. Average review time for acepted papers is 87 days.

Submission after corrections

If your manuscript needs corrections you may resubmit after revisions have been made. In this case, you need to provide a respond letter to explain in detail each change, point by point, the corrected manuscript with highlighted changes and a clean version of corrected manuscript.

Once manuscript has been resubmitted, Editor decides whether or not accept revised manuscript or send it back to reviewers for further comments. Editor has the final decision based on the reviewers recommendations.

Acepted manuscript

Once manuscript has been accepted for publication, it is immediately turned to the production process. Authors will receive the gallery proof of the manuscript that should be returned maximum 48 hours. As soon as received, it is processed the final production process and then publishes the paper on line allocated on the corresponding issue. Authors will receive a confirmation email of posting.

Type of Publication

Letters to the Editor

They will be submitted to the same evaluation requirements and processes as the standard paper, but peer-review process should be accelerated taking final decision maximum four weeks. The section of Letters to the Editor is designed for original contributions in the form of comments, replies of already published articles, and preliminary results highlighting single result that deserve a faster publication because of relevance. It is limited to 4 pages including figures and tables.

Full-length paper

This is the standard paper and it is considered the space to publish original research in details providing more information and findings. It is expected more than 4 pages.

Review paper

Review paper is published only by invitation. In this case, it is expected a detailed review of recent progress on a particular topic. It must summarize the current knowledge on the selected topic and provide and understanding of the topic for readers by discussing relevant results reported in recent research papers.

Journal History

It was created in March 2008, and published its first issue in November of the same year. Since then, it is regularly issued in the months of May and November. Subsequently, it has been included in different indexes such as Redalyc, Latindex, Dialnet, DOAJ, etc; since 2012 it belongs to the Índice de Revistas Mexicanas de Investigación (Index of Mexican Research Journals) of the CONACYT. It is currently included in the collection SciELO Citation Index of Web of Science.
